The nightly pipeline for SnackRoute's restock planner began failing after the solver container was rebuilt with a newer base image. Investigation showed the route-optimization step reads machine inventory fixtures with stricter schema validation, rejecting two legacy test files. We regenerated the fixtures, pinned the base image digest, and confirmed no credentials or secrets were exposed in the failing logs. All twelve pipeline stages now pass cleanly. The passing run can be verified against the token below.

trace token, tawep-fahif: htk3_b58

## Cron Drift Investigation — Onboarding Notes

When reviewing fixes for the Bellhaven scheduler drift, verify that job timestamps are compared in UTC and that the NTP offset check added in the Quillmont patch remains intact. Any change to the drift-correction module must be accompanied by updated tolerance tests. Corrected scheduler builds are deployed through the signed pipeline, which requires the deploy key below.

signing key of kahog-kadup = bky13_6wLyxnPsJob4P

On-call note for Frostbin archival: cold storage buckets at Hollen Systems are archived every Sunday by the `glacierize` job. If it fails, re-run manually only after confirming the manifest checksum matches. Never delete source buckets yourself. The archive signing vault unlocks with the passphrase provided directly below.

unlock words, fafop-hawep: briwyn-oliix-sorox

☐ Unseal the Tallow tax-rate lookup cache. Plugin authors: your rate queries will 503 until this step is done, so don't panic during the ceremony window. One keyholder runs the unseal command on the Bryce node; when it prompts, they read out the cache recovery passphrase while a second person confirms it. For this ceremony, the passphrase is the following.

vault phrase of tajop-haduf = holath-brivan-wenax